This page documents how Hushline release artifacts are traced from source to deployment. Each deduplicator build is produced on an isolated runner, with dependencies pinned by lockfile hash and no network access during compilation. The signing step records the commit, runner image digest, and pipeline run in an attestation stored alongside the artifact. Reviewers should confirm that the attestation chain is unbroken before approving promotion. The artifact currently under review is identified by the token below.

trace token, kajef-bahip: htk14_d9270d12f0002c

**CI note: timezone weirdness in report exports**

Heads up, support folks — if a customer says their Ledgerpine export shows times shifted by a few hours, it's probably the CI image. The export workers got rebuilt last week and the base image defaults to UTC, while older workers used the account's locale. Fix is rolling out; meanwhile tell customers the data itself is fine, just the display offset. Affected exports carry the build token shown below.

build token for bajof-tahop: htk4_a981

Hey Marco — quick handover before the eng sync.

Per-tenant rate quotas on Quillbridge moved out of the old hardcoded map last sprint, so you can finally stop editing that cursed YAML by hand. Quotas now live in the limiter service and reload every five minutes. Big tenants like the Orvalle pilot get custom tiers; everyone else falls into the default bucket. Watch the burst multiplier — it bites if set too high. Here are the current quota settings for the limiter.

settings of fajop-fahap:
[holeth]
port = 9300
team = juleth
host = holeth.tolvaqsoft.example
region = south-4
access_code = ac_4bcdf6
timeout_ms = 500

## Pinmark Autocomplete — Environments

Quick reference for the Pinmark address autocomplete widget. It runs in three environments: sandbox (fake addresses only, great for demos), staging, and production. If a customer says suggestions are blank, first check which environment their embed key points at — nine times out of ten it's a sandbox key on a live site. Rate limits and suggestion counts differ per environment; the current values are listed below.

deployment values, kagef-hahap:
wenael:
  log_level: warn
  metrics_host: metrics.wenael.qorvelsys.internal
  pin: 3768
  pool_size: 32